Idina Menzel is sharing how she compares herself to her Frozen character Elsa as the blockbuster franchise marches ahead with its upcoming third movie.
Menzel, 55, appeared at the Honda Center in Anaheim, Calif. during D23 on Friday, Aug. 14 alongside her Frozen costars Kristen Bell and Josh Gad to preview Frozen 3 before it hits theaters in 2027. When the trio chatted with PEOPLE at the event, Menzel said that she feels she can “emulate” her fan-favorite character as she steps into her third film voicing Elsa.
“She’s a good role model for me because now she’s not apologizing for who she is,” Menzel says. “I feel like I’m getting much better into owning my power and finding that. So she’s always been a shining example.”
Elsa has magical powers that enable her to manipulate snow and ice. The first Frozen movie, released in 2013, deals with her attempts to hide her powers as a child and her estranged sister Anna’s quest to find Elsa after she flees the kingdom and accidentally creates an unending winter. Frozen sees Elsa learn to control her powers through finding love for her family. The 2019 sequel expands on the origins of Elsa’s magical powers.
When Gad, 45, and Bell, 46, were asked whether they feel their characters have rubbed off on them, Gad jests, “I’m least like my character in that I’m not a snowman.”

“I think we both share just a disease of whatever comes to our head, our mouth doesn’t stop us. We just have no off button — just say it out loud,” he says.
Bell, for her part, adds, “Anna has a similar thing in that I am probably more like Anna in many ways than almost any other character I’ve played. Wearing my heart on my sleeve, jumping into action, probably being pretty codependent and talking before I think.”
“Maybe that’s where Olaf learned it from,” Gad quips.

During Frozen 3‘s presentation at D23 on Aug. 14, Bell and Menzel sang a song seemingly from the new movie and Gad sang a new Olaf-centric tune about being in love. The trio explained that in the series’ third installment, Anna and Kristoff (Jonathan Groff) will get married and Olaf himself will fall in love. Bell, Menzel and Gad showed a teaser for the forthcoming movie at the event, and the night ended with snow confetti falling from the ceiling.
Frozen 3 will be released in theaters on Nov. 24, 2027. Disney confirmed back in 2023 that Frozen 4 is also in development, but a release date for that sequel has not yet been announced.
